What is called molting in birds? How long does the moult last for birds?

What is called molting in birds? This is the process by which the feather cover changes. For birds, it is a necessity. Over time, feathers wear out, lose thermal qualities and affect even the ability to fly. When molting, the layer of the epidermis also changes, which periodically dies. Updated scales on the paws and plates of the beak.

In all birds molting occurs in different ways. Someone quickly, some last more than six months. Some birds molt abundantly, so that even the bald patches are formed, while others may not notice the process of changing the feathers. However, they all share one thing - weakening of immunity. Feathers become less mobile, they experience drowsiness. Also, birds during molting need more caloric food. As for domestic animals, they require more thorough care during this period.

Types of molting

There are two types of molting:

  1. Juvenile - in young individuals. It occurs in all birds at different times. For example, in chicks, juvenile molting begins at the age of 3-45 days from birth and ends in about 4-5 months. And for young individuals of waterfowl this molt occurs somewhat later. It begins at the age of 60-70 days, but ends after 2 months.
  2. Periodic - this is a molt in adults, which occurs once a year.

What is moulting in birds? This is a periodic change of plumage. In adults, in natural conditions, it does not depend on age, but on the season. Usually it's the end of summer or autumn. But in birds, contained in captivity, molting occurs only after oviposition.

What is necessary for birds during moulting

During this period, the immunity of birds is weakened, and their body needs additional micronutrients. If in the natural habitat the birds are intuitively finding everything they need, then the birds living at home need additional care. This includes mandatory vitamin supplements and special foods. This is especially necessary for those who have the process in the winter. Birds with bright colors need more attention than others. If they are fed incorrectly, the plumage will become dim.

Molting in hens: features

Due to the fact that there is a possibility of climate regulation, the moulting process does not depend on the season at all. The chicken, hatched in the spring, molts at the beginning of winter or at the end of autumn. Accordingly, if it was born in the fall, then this process occurs at the end of spring or summer. During moult the chicken does not carry eggs. It lasts from 15 to 20 days. After the moult, the egg-laying of the chicken is immediately resumed.

Individuals that were born in the spring are mainly grown to produce meat. Because the period of carrying eggs is short, keeping such a bird on the farm is unprofitable. In this case molting in such hens proceeds very slowly.

How does the plumage change in parrots

In these birds, the process occurs several times a year. The very first molt of parrots begins at the age of two months. This period is very important, because the sexual maturation of the individual. After the moulting, the parrot is considered to be adult and sexually mature.

This is a vital process for the normal existence of birds. Feathers change not only during puberty, but also throughout life. Usually this happens twice a year. At the same time the bird becomes inactive, lethargy and drowsiness appear. This is due to the fact that metabolic processes are intensified during molting.

The plumage also changes after the mating period. In some species, the molting process is generally invisible, no bald patches are observed. But if the feathers fall out unbalanced, then the parrot can not fly at this time. Moulting is often a reaction of a bird to fright. Sometimes this is a symptom of a serious illness.
